This audiobook is narrated by a digital voice. The global market is a colossal machine, a complex and ever-evolving system that connects nations, cultures, and economies in unprecedented ways. This book, The Global Market Machine: How Trade Shapes Our World, aims to provide a comprehensive understanding of this intricate mechanism, exploring its historical trajectory, its underlying principles, and its far-reaching consequences. We begin by examining the genesis of global trade, tracing its origins from ancient trade routes like the Silk Road to the sophisticated interconnectedness of the modern era. We will unravel the mechanics of international trade, explaining concepts such as comparative advantage, exchange rates, and the balance of payments in clear and accessible language. A significant focus will be on the roles played by trade agreements, both free trade and protectionist, and the influence of international institutions like the World Trade Organization (WTO). The dynamics of trade wars, tariffs, and non-tariff barriers will be analyzed, highlighting their impacts on global commerce and the livelihoods of individuals around the world. We will then explore the intricate workings of global supply chains, revealing their efficiency, their vulnerabilities, and their potential for both positive and negative consequences. The book will also address the critical issue of the unequal distribution of the benefits of trade, examining the impact on developed and developing economies, and focusing on job displacement, economic growth, and inequality. By providing a nuanced and detailed exploration of the global market machine, this book empowers readers to become informed participants in global economic discussions, fostering a more critical and comprehensive understanding of trade’s profound impact on our world.
